Best Mouse I've Ever Used (Medium/Large Hands & Fingertip Grip)
My history with Roccat is long and sordid. I love the design of their products but they usually tend to have one or more fatal flaws that rear their heads over time. I owned the original Roccat Kone back in 2019 (bought it to play Apex Legends) and loved it except for when the mouse wheel started registering my up-scrolls as down-scrolls. Roccat design has always been A+ but their quality control has been more like a C+.The Kone Pure Ultra is basically the Kone with no flaws. It only has one lighting zone, so it's a little more understated, and it's ever so slightly smaller while still preserving the ergonomic design with the thumb groove on the left.For me, this is the most comfortable mouse I've ever owned. I have medium to large hands. This is probably the most direct successor to the legendary MX518 you can find in terms of shape and feel. I used a G502 for years and liked it but found that its narrow shape left my hands cramping and would blister my pinky finger over time. That design is better suited for gamers with smaller frames and hands. Guys like Shroud or XQC.The Kone Pro Ultra has the PERFECT amount of width for someone who has medium to large hands and uses a fingertip grip.Accuracy at 1000hz polling rate is fantastic, and all the buttons have a satisfying feel. The side mouse buttons are pristinely positioned and unlike other mice, they are curved and flat, meaning you don't have to deal with a sharp edge digging into your thumb all the time.Now onto the BEST part of this mouse for me, aside from its shape and size - the scroll wheel. I've gone through SO many mice trying to find the perfect scroll wheel, and they have ALL either become sludgy over time to where the notches are indiscernible, OR they begin malfunctioning.In my FPS games, I bind middle mouse to toggle crouch and I use scroll up and scroll down for weapon 1 and weapon 2, so I am using the scroll wheel A LOT. I also do IT for my job and I work from home, so the scroll wheel sees lots of use here.I am happy to report that I've owned this mouse since February 2023 and it still functions like day 1. No malfunctions, the middle mouse click still feels great, and the notches when scrolling up or down can still clearly be felt. Hallelujah.I will note that I replaced the stock feet on this mouse with some PTFE Corepad Skatez. The default feet were fine but did start to get a little worn down after about 4 months. I've had zero issues since replacing the feet, which have lasted me 6 months with no wear. I like that there are only two mouse feet and that they are BIG. There are less things that can go wrong and overall more contact area with the mouse pad. I'm using a Skypad 3.0 glass mousepad for reference.One nitpicky criticism of this mouse is that the cable is standard rubber. A braided or paracord cable would be great if this mouse is redesigned in the future.But that doesn't take away from the fact that this mouse has the perfect size for medium to large handed fingertip grippers, amazing ergonomics, and the best scroll wheel on the market.An easy recommendation if you meet the above criteria and want to click on some heads on FPS games.
